US Dollar Turns⁤ Red on Friday Ahead of Trump’s Inauguration

In⁣ a striking development in the foreign exchange market, ‍the US dollar experienced a notable​ decline on friday,​ just days⁤ before the inauguration of President-elect Donald Trump. As traders adn investors brace for ‍potential shifts⁤ in economic policy, the dollar weakened against a basket of ⁣major ⁣currencies, reflecting heightened uncertainty and speculation regarding the incoming governance’s fiscal strategies. Market analysts are closely watching for signals that‍ could impact the ⁢currency’s trajectory, as Trump’s promises of aggressive tax reforms and infrastructure​ spending loom large‌ in the economic landscape. This downturn ⁤comes in the broader context of fluctuating global markets, where geopolitical factors and domestic ⁢economic indicators are increasingly influencing currency valuations.
